A Victorian Silver and Coral Rattle
by George Unite, Birmingham, 1861

baluster and chased with foliage and flowers, with a single row of seven bells, with whistle and suspension loop at one end and coral teether at the other

15.2cm long

Sold for £140
Estimated at £100 - £200


 

Marked on ferrule with lion passant, town mark, duty mark and date letter, struck on whistle with maker's mark. There is some surface scratching and wear, consistent with age and use. One bell lacking. The coral teether has been re-glued.
